Real Time Clocks Microchip Technology MCP79402T-I/MS Overview
The Real Time Clocks Microchip Technology MCP79402T-I/MS is an advanced integrated circuit designed for sophisticated time-tracking and calendar management across various applications. Developed by Microchip Technology, this IC utilizes an I2C interface and is housed in a compact 8-MSOP package, making it ideal for systems where space and reliable timekeeping are critical. Its primary function includes managing time and date information in real-time, ensuring accuracy and reliability in time-sensitive applications. This product is particularly valuable for designers looking for a low-power yet highly functional real-time clock (RTC) solution.
MCP79402T-I/MS Features
This IC boasts features such as battery backup capability, which ensures the clock continues running even in the event of a power loss. Additionally, it includes ample EEPROM memory for data storage, a unique MAC address for networked devices, and the ability to generate a programmable square wave output, which is useful for timing applications. Its low-power consumption makes it an ideal choice for portable and battery-operated devices.
MCP79402T-I/MS Applications
- Consumer Electronics: Used in devices like smart home systems and wearables where accurate time is crucial for functionality and user experience.
- Industrial Systems: Integrated into manufacturing equipment to provide time stamps and manage scheduled maintenance or operations.
- Networking Equipment: Helps in the management of log files and provides time-based functions in routers and switches.
- Portable Devices: Essential for maintaining clock accuracy in devices such as handheld GPS units, which rely on precise timing for navigation.
- Medical Devices: Used in medical monitoring systems where timestamping is crucial for tracking patient data and ensuring synchronization across various monitoring equipment.
